  <title>reverse mutation</title>
  <longtitle>IUPAC Gold Book - reverse mutation</longtitle>
  <doi>10.1351/goldbook.16054</doi>
  <code>16054</code>
  <status>current</status>
  <synonym><em>synonym</em>: back mutation</synonym>
  <definitions>
    <item>
      <id>1</id>
      <text>Mutation in a mutant allele which makes it capable of producing the nonmutant phenotype; this may result from restoration of the original DNA sequence of the gene or from production of a new DNA sequence which has the same effect.</text>
